EV Charging Stations Being Installed at County Stop & ShopsAt every launched store, customers will be able to access two electric vehicle charging stations, featuring Volta Charging's high-resolution, two-sided digital displays. Customers with electric vehicles can park in the designated spaces and charge while they shop. On average, a Volta charging station can deliver up to 30 miles of range per hour. Berkshire Gas Stations Receive MassEVIP GrantsEquilon Enterprises LLC, doing business as Shell Oil Products US, has gas stations in Cheshire, Great Barrington, and Pittsfield. Each station will receive $100,000 to install two ports. |
